Core i3-1000NG4
The Core i3-1000NG4 is manufactured by Intel. It was released in 18 March 2020 (5 years ago). It is based on the Ice Lake-Y (2020) architecture. It features 2 cores and 4 threads. Base frequency is 1.1 GHz, with boost up to 3.2 GHz. L3 cache: 4 MB (total). L2 cache: 256 kB (per core). Built on 10 nm process technology. Socket: BGA1044. Thermal design power (TDP): 9 Watt. Memory support: LPDDR4-3733. Passmark benchmark score: 3,530 points. Launch price was $69.

Core i7-6650U
The Core i7-6650U is manufactured by Intel. It was released in 1 September 2015 (10 years ago). It is based on the Skylake (2015β2016) architecture. It features 2 cores and 4 threads. Base frequency is 2.2 GHz, with boost up to 3.4 GHz. L3 cache: 4 MB. L2 cache: 512 kB. Built on 14 nm process technology. Socket: BGA1356. Thermal design power (TDP): 15 Watt. Memory support: DDR3, DDR4. Passmark benchmark score: 3,557 points. Launch price was $415.
Processing Power
Both the Core i3-1000NG4 and Core i7-6650U share an identical 2-core/4-thread configuration. Boost clocks reach 3.2 GHz on the Core i3-1000NG4 versus 3.4 GHz on the Core i7-6650U β a 6.1% clock advantage for the Core i7-6650U (base: 1.1 GHz vs 2.2 GHz). The Core i3-1000NG4 uses the Ice Lake-Y (2020) architecture (10 nm), while the Core i7-6650U uses Skylake (2015β2016) (14 nm). In PassMark, the Core i3-1000NG4 scores 3,530 against the Core i7-6650U's 3,557 β a 0.8% lead for the Core i7-6650U. L3 cache: 4 MB (total) on the Core i3-1000NG4 vs 4 MB on the Core i7-6650U.
